Accommodation:

GROUND FLOOR

Entrance into hallway with stairs to first floor and doors to all rooms.
Open plan lounge/diner with comfortable seating, Smart TV and electric fire.
Dining area with table and chairs for six and French doors to rear decking.
Kitchen area with built-in double electric oven and ceramic hob, fridge/freezer, dishwasher, washer/dryer and Megimix coffee machine.
Cloakroom with basin and WC.

FIRST FLOOR

Bedroom 1 with 5ft king size bed, bedside tables, hanging space and views over the garden.
Bedroom 2 with 4’6 double size bed, bedside tables, hanging space and desk.
Bedroom 3 with bunk beds and overlooking the garden.
Family Bathroom with walk-in shower, bath, basin and WC.
